Here is a poem written by Pam’s Dad, Vernon Amero.
DON’T FORGET FLANDERS FIELD
Flanders Field where our brave men and women lay;
Where they died for freedom, we enjoy today.
Our men and women, we shall never forget;
on Remembrance Day, shake the hand of a Vet.
As years go by, and our parades diminish;
what someone else started our Veterans finished.
Let’s teach our children, what war was all about;
and when they see the parade, there will be no doubt.
Teach them to pray, there will be no more war;
and to always remember, those that went before.
